The Opportunity:

Our client is a leading environmental consulting firm delivering reclamation, remediation, and environmental management services across Western Canada. They are seeking an experienced Project Manager to lead a diverse portfolio of environmental projects, ranging from individual site assessments to large-scale reclamation and remediation programs. This is an exciting opportunity for a collaborative leader who enjoys managing projects from start to finish, mentoring technical teams, and building strong client relationships while contributing to environmentally responsible solutions.

What You'll Be Doing:
  • Lead and manage reclamation, remediation, and environmental consulting projects from planning through completion.
  • Oversee large-scale environmental programs while ensuring projects are delivered safely, on schedule, and within budget.
  • Provide leadership, mentorship, and technical guidance to Project Coordinators, Environmental Specialists, Environmental Analysts, and field staff.
  • Manage project budgets, forecasting, schedules, resource planning, and overall project performance.
  • Prepare project status updates, financial reports, forecasts, and progress summaries for internal and external stakeholders.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for clients, maintaining strong relationships and ensuring successful project execution.
  • Ensure compliance with corporate health, safety, environmental, and regulatory requirements.
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ary technical teams to deliver integrated environmental solutions.
  • Support continuous improvement initiatives, including development of processes, templates, and implementation of new technologies.
  • Mentor and develop junior team members while contributing to a collaborative and high-performing work environment.
What You'll Need to Be Successful:
  • Minimum 5 years of experience in environmental consulting, project management, or a combination of both.
  • Degree or diploma in Environmental Science, Biology, Ecology, Engineering, or a related field.
  • Professional designation, or eligibility for registration, with a recognized professional association (e.g., AIA, ASPB, APEGA, APEGS, or equivalent).
  • Demonstrated experience managing reclamation, remediation, or environmental consulting projects.
  • Strong knowledge of Alberta and Saskatchewan reclamation regulations and contaminated site management.
  • Experience with native grassland reclamation and minimum disturbance wellsite reclamation is considered an asset.
  • Excellent project management, leadership, organizational, and communication skills.
  • Strong technical writing, analytical, budgeting, and forecasting abilities.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ities while leading multidisciplinary teams in a consulting environment.
  • Experience in one or more of the following areas is preferred:
  • Contaminated Site Assessment, Remediation & Management
  • Land Reclamation
  • Land Conservation & Management
  • Environmental Program Management
